• You can't alias the "*"

    You need a comma after the star, like so: DECLARE @Employee TABLE (FullName varchar(10), Salary money)

    INSERT INTO @Employee

    SELECT 'John Doe', 85000 UNION ALL

    SELECT 'Jane Doe', 87244 UNION ALL

    SELECT 'John Doe', 77854 UNION ALL

    SELECT 'John Doe', 94875

    SELECT

    *, ROUND( (Salary * .1), 2) AS Raise

    FROM @Employee You should always write out the columns names wherever possible and refrain from using "*" when possible.

    Ex:DECLARE @Employee TABLE (FullName varchar(50), Salary money)

    INSERT INTO @Employee

    SELECT 'John Doe', 85000 UNION ALL

    SELECT 'Jane Doe', 87244 UNION ALL

    SELECT 'Tim McGraw', 77854 UNION ALL

    SELECT 'Arnold Stumph', 94875

    SELECT

    FullName [LuckyBa$tard], Salary, ROUND( (Salary * .1), 2) AS Raise

    FROM @Employee

    ______________________________________________________________________________Never argue with an idiot; Theyll drag you down to their level and beat you with experience